Do we really spend Day/Night 1 voting randomly, as some seem to be doing? Or are we supposed to be analyzing the behavior of our fellows and acting accordingly?

I don’t have the lingo down yet, but I’ve noted folks that babble/fluff; folks that are oddly defensive about what exactly (because we just started); folks that are really focused on the whole editing thing; and a whole bunch of quiet, lurking folks who are just gathering data. I think the last group is the dangerous one.

So which is it: Day 1 is a dart throw (so heads down and hope the crowd forgets you) or Day 1 is based on some kind of “logic” (so get in there and throw elbows)?

No such thing. That thing does not exist.

We try to use as much “logic” as possible, but without any concrete information to go on, that’s rather difficult. I’d say that long term, we probably do better than a “dart throw”, but just barely.

Day 1 votes are mostly random, but the point of them is to see how people defend themselves. Or whether they defend themselves. Or how they justify their votes. Or whether they justify their votes. Or what they say. Or what they don’t say.

Since this game is on a message board, every single thing goes on the record. Something that’s inconspicuous today might be part of a solid case on Day 5.

Most stuff that happens on Day 1 is geared towards getting people talking and getting on the record.
